Reinforced Concrete has a major defect that is weak in tension strength and is very brittle. As the intensity increased, this feature is more obvious. If applied in complex stress areas such as beam-column joints, it is easy to crack, the shear capacity and seismic performance are very low. Compared with ordinary concrete structures, the shear capacity and seismic performance of steel fiber reinforced concrete have improved significantly. Therefore, considering the advantages of steel fiber reinforced concrete and high strength concrete, the performance research of steel fiber reinforced concrete frame joint have important theoretical and practical value.Through a test including steel fiber reinforced concrete frame joints under cyclic loading test. the author analyses that four experimental parameters' effect in specimens'mechanics capability and seismic capacity. The parameters are axial compression ratio, volume and mixing area of steel fiber, volume of the core area of stirrup. We also research if steel fiber replaces the feasibility of stirrups in the core area. The main contents are as follows:(1) The paper carries out a test including 5 frame joints under cyclic loading. The specimens are divided into 2 groups. We analyze the impact of axial load ratio, volume and mixing area of steel fiber, volume of the core area of stirrup on the crack,also study the failure mode.(2) According to the Hysteretic curve of frame side joint from the test, we analyze the energy dissipation capacity of each frame joint and parameter's effect on the seismic performance.(4) According to analyze components'stress, we discuss the nodes of cracking and shear mechanism, put forward the force mode on Steel Fiber Reinforced Concrete frame joints.
